Upper Wheatvale · Suburb / Locality
Where people and their families come from — the ancestries they identify with and where they were born.
Australian ancestry is the most common heritage in Upper Wheatvale, where 44.4% of people claim this background. The area has a small population with a strong tie to its roots, though a notable minority were born outside Australia.
The ancestries people most identify with.
Australian, English, and Irish ancestries are the most frequent, making up 44.4%, 17.8% and 11.1% of the population respectively.
Australia and the largest overseas communities.
While 17.8% of residents were born overseas—a figure higher than most similar areas—this is still well below the Queensland rate of 22.7% and the national figure of 27.7%.
